Bridge Snapshot: BUDDHA BYPASS

The BUDDHA BYPASS bridge in Lawrence, Indiana carries BUDDHA BYPASS over EAST FORK WHITE RIVER. It was built in 1996, making it 30 years old today. The structure is built primarily of steel continuous and spans 5 sections, stretching 152.7 meters (501 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 785 vehicles, placing it in the lower-traffic tier of Indiana bridges. It is owned and maintained by County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 7/9, superstructure at 8/9, substructure at 7/9. The weakest component sits in good condition. None of this bridge's reported major components fall into the Poor condition range. Its NBI inventory load rating is 35.5 metric tons.

How to read this record

This page shows what the last federal inspection recorded, not whether BUDDHA BYPASS is safe to cross today. Here is how to use it.

  • NBI condition ratings reflect the latest record in this annual dataset, not a live status. Current routine inspection intervals are risk-based.
  • Learn how the 0–9 condition scale and Good/Fair/Poor categories are defined. How condition ratings work
  • Compare BUDDHA BYPASS against other structures in Lawrence and across Indiana. Indiana bridges
  • Noticed visible damage or a safety concern? Report it to the agency that owns the bridge, or call 911 in an emergency. How to report a bridge

Condition codes come straight from the FHWA National Bridge Inventory and are not a real-time safety judgment. Only the owning agency, a state DOT, county, or other owner, can post, restrict, or close a bridge.
